Coyotes, Jacks Players Honored

Three players each from South Dakota and South Dakota State were named to the Summit League women’s all conference tennis team.

South Dakota tennis players junior Yuliya Sidenko, freshman Ellie Burns and classmate Elise van Zijst were three of 12 players selected.

South Dakota State University players Tacy Haws-Lay, Beatriz Souza and Morgan Brower earned All-Summit League honors

The Summit tournament opens Saturday at 9 a.m. at the Koch Family Tennis Center in Omaha when the No. 3-seeded Jackrabbits face. No. 2-seed South Dakota.
